## SEC. 602 REQUIREMENT FOR DEPARTMENT OF VETERANS AFFAIRS INTERNET WEBSITE TO PROVIDE INFORMATION ON SERVICES AVAILABLE TO WOMEN VETERANS **[**[38 U.S.C. 6303 note](/us/usc/t38/s6303)**]** ###
(a)In General The Secretary of Veterans Affairs shall survey the internet websites and information resources of the Department of Veterans Affairs in effect on the day before the date of the enactment of this Act and publish an internet website that serves as a centralized source for the provision to women veterans of information about the benefits and services available to them under laws administered by the Secretary. ###
(b)Elements The internet website published under subsection
(a)shall provide to women veterans information regarding all services available in the district in which the veteran is seeking such services, including, with respect to each medical center and community-based outpatient clinic in the applicable Veterans Integrated Service Network— ####
(1)the name and contact information of each women’s health coordinator; ####
(2)a list of appropriate staff for other benefits available from the Veterans Benefits Administration, the National Cemetery Administration, and such other entities as the Secretary considers appropriate; and ####
(3)such other information as the Secretary considers appropriate. ###
(c)Updated Information The Secretary shall ensure that the information described in subsection
(b)that is published on the internet website required by subsection
(a)is updated not less frequently than once every 90 days. ###
(d)Outreach In carrying out this section, the Secretary shall ensure that the outreach conducted under section 1720F(i) of title 38, United States Code, includes information regarding the internet website required by subsection (a). ###
(e)Derivation of Funds Amounts used by the Secretary to carry out this section shall be derived from amounts made available to the Secretary to publish internet websites of the Department. # TITLE VII OTHER MATTERS
